Fig. 2 in The dorsal shell wall structure of Mesozoic ammonoids
Fig. 2. Schematic drawing of general dorsal shell wall types (A1, B1, transversal section, centrifugal; A2, B2, median section, growth direction left, centrifugal). A. Reduced dorsal shell wall. The lateral shell wall wedges out at the contact with the preceding whorl. The dorsal wall is omitted at the aperture. B. Complete dorsal shell wall. The ventral, lateral, and dorsal shell walls form a continuum. The dorsal wall is present at the aperture. Colouring: black, ventral/lateral wall of the succeeding whorl; dark grey, dorsal wall of the succeeding whorl; light grey, septum of the succeeding whorl; white, ventral wall of the preceding whorl.
